Full Transcript Below: When the Fall and Winter Seasons Feel HeavyBy Vivian Bricker Bible Reading:“When anxiety was great within me, your consolation brought me joy.” - Psalm 94:19 Autumn is a season of beautiful leaves, crisp air, and an endless array of pumpkin-themed sweets. For many, the autumn season rings in fond memories and excitement for the upcoming holidays. However, for some, the colder months loom like a dark cloud. At one time, I, too, loved the autumn season as I was excited to see the leaves change, go trick-or-treating, and get ready for the start of the holiday season. However, each fall has a heaviness over it ever since my mom passed away a few autumns ago. Ever since then, it has been difficult to associate these months with anything else. Fall can be heavy, and it can be overwhelming at times for many of us. Perhaps, like me, you experienced a traumatic life event that clouds each autumn with sad memories. Or, perhaps you experience seasonal depression during the fall and winter - something that is common among many people. The days get shorter, and we’re left in darkness for much longer. Know that whatever it may be that is bringing heaviness into your life during this time, you are not alone. If you feel that fall is a difficult season to navigate, it is essential to talk with God as well as loved ones about what you are feeling. Reaching out to medical professionals can also be helpful if you ever have concerns about depression, anxiety, or thoughts of self-harm. Even if you only have minimal concerns around any of these things, be proactive about addressing them with your primary care provider. Intersecting Faith & Life: The Bible tells us, “When anxiety was great within me, your consolation brought me joy” (Psalm 94:19). Although fall can bring much sorrow into our hearts, God can also bring joy into them. Whenever our hearts are full of anxiety, sorrow, or pain, we need to go to the Lord in prayer. God's consolation will bring us joy. God understands the pain we are feeling and how certain seasons can cause painful memories or depression to resurface. Despite the pain and heartbreak we are experiencing, God can help us to see the light of life again. Even if you think you will never enjoy fall again or you won't be able to walk into autumn without pain, know that it is more than possible. All things are possible with God (Matthew 19:26). The heaviness may continue; however, try to allow God to heal your weary heart. God may provide healing through your family, friends, or spouse. Make new memories with those around you and treasure the memories of the past. We might always feel a bit heavy when fall comes around, but sometimes this heaviness can keep our loved ones close to our hearts. Why does this season feel especially heavy for you? How can you bring those things to God? He longs to bring joy to a weary heart - all you need to do is reach for Him. How do we make it through the difficult seasons that every marriage encounters? What does contentment look like when our circumstances aren't changing? For musicians Cubbie Fink and Rebecca St. James, they could not have predicted the many twists and turns life would take on after they said, "I do." Through the personal pain of miscarriage and fertility struggles, the ups and downs of two successful music careers, and the revelation of Cubbie's childhood trauma that needed healing, Cubbie and Rebecca have experienced difficult winter seasons that tested their marriage and their faith. But it was through those seasons that they found an invitation to grow and trust God in their lives together. They wrote about it in their new book, Lasting Ever: Faith, Music, Family and Being Found by True Love, which shares the heartaches and triumphs that shaped their story as a couple. In this episode, Davey sits down with Cubbie and Rebecca to discuss the different seasons that marriages often encounter, how to hold space for one another in pain, and why contentment is so important in the winters of our lives. If you're walking through a difficult season in your marriage or in life, this conversation will encourage you that even when it feels dark, God is always there beside you and that every winter season is a reminder that spring is coming. https://wisdom-trek.com/wp-content/uploads/2016/06/Wisdom-Trek2800.jpg () Wisdom-Trek / Creating a Legacy Welcome to Day 403 of our Wisdom-Trek, and thank you for joining me. This is Guthrie Chamberlain, Your Guide to Wisdom The Cycles and Seasons of Life (10) – Make Your Winter Seasons Count Thank you for joining us for our 5 days per week wisdom and legacy podcast. This is Day 403 of our trek, and today is Philosophy Friday. Every Friday we will ponder some of the basic truths and mysteries of life and how they can impact us in creating our living legacy. Today we will complete our trek covering the Cycles and Seasons of Life. We will continue the winter season that we started last Friday and then wrap up the trek with a recap https://wisdom-trek.com/wp-content/uploads/2016/02/personal-philosophy-jim-rohn-e1439505400958.png () We are broadcasting from our studio at Home2 in Charlotte, North Carolina. Our workload has been steady this week, and we continue to make slow but sure progress on the various projects we are working on. This is not unlike the cycles that a farmer goes through during the various seasons of the year. The analogy comparing waiting for the Lord's return to the farmer in James 5:7 explains life pretty well, “Dear brothers and sisters, be patient as you wait for the Lord's return. Consider the farmers who patiently wait for the rains in the fall and in the spring. They eagerly look for the valuable harvest to ripen.” To be successful in life, it is imperative that we fully understand the laws of planting and harvesting. Realize also that during your lifetime, there will be many different cycles of seasons. Just because particular cycles of seasons did not produce the harvest you expected, don't let that control future seasons or the entirety of your life. Today on our trek, let us continue the winter season which must be a time for reflection and planning while each new spring season gives you an opportunity to start new again. Today's trek is titled… Make Your Winter Seasons Count As we continue to contemplate the winter seasons of life, you need to grasp that throughout all the seasons of the year. Winter can touch your lives in many small ways, as if it were testing you and providing you with subtle reminders of the plight of those whose lives are surrounded by winter. Winter can be a lost opportunity or the loss of love. A winter is when a trusted friend gives you cause for disappointment when your children young or old make unwise decisions that will force them into a winter season, or even when expected business goes to a competitor. A frigid blast from the cold, harsh words of someone you love is winter, and so is the pessimism or cynicism from someone whose advice and counsel you seek. The major challenge confronting those who seem to be in a perpetual winter is that they don't prepare for the arrival of spring, and lack the ability to recognize that arrival. So that you don't become like this yourself, you must be planning, learning, and preparing so that you become part of the solution rather than allowing yourself to remain part of the problem. https://wisdom-trek.com/wp-content/uploads/2016/08/8873731444_997a921434_z.jpg () If you are currently without love, money, or employment, it is a winter, and its very appearance is because you've missed a springtime somewhere. Even if it was not your intention, neglect is always costly, and winter is merely a circumstance—an effect brought on by some earlier cause. Dwelling on the severity of your personal winter merely makes the winter more difficult to endure. You must search the inner confines of your mind and your soul for the purpose of discovering the real cause within you. Adversity is seldom attributable to someone or something outside of ourselves. To blame outside influences for the circumstance of winter is a convenient excuse for misplacing your responsibility. It is the normal human tendency to place...
